In this story we follow Cheyenne and Rafe. This couple long to be together, however there is 2 things keeping them apart. Firstly Rafe’s family don’t think Cheyenne is good enough for Rafe since she doesn’t want and rejects her magic. However the biggest thing is that Rafe is already promised to another Witch called Meredith. Meredith is a very powerful Witch and very dangerous as she doesn’t use her magic for good. When Meredith finds out that Rafe doesn’t want to marry her she gets angry and goes for the one person he wants Cheyenne. Now Cheyenne and Rafe need to find a way to stop Meredith before she can cause anymore harm. But when Cheyenne tries to reach her magic she can’t make it work. Has her magic deserted her after she rejected it? Will Cheyenne be able to defeat Meredith even with her magic? And what lengths will Meredith go to to stop Rafe being with the woman he really loves. This is a romance with a twist of a lover scorned and magic thrown into the mix.

I read Witch Switch by Louisa Bacio in this anthology. This book was intriguing. Love, mystery, revenge…toss in hidden powers, unknown siblings and losing yourself and having to refind yourself, you have the makings of a good tale. This is a novella but the author didn’t quite leave us hanging. It is the start of a series. HOORAY! I can’t wait to read more. This was like a bad fairytale that you can root for good to win. Rafe, Cheyenne, and Jupiter can kick butt with the best of them. I loved the fact that Cheyenne and Jupiter are strong and can basically do things on their own (together-sister power), there’s another sister later in the story. The characters have strong personalities. Meredith may have evil powers yet she’s pretty much a spoiled brat not getting her way. The plot had a really good flow. The story wasn’t choppy. My favorite part was the scene in the forest. The whole tone of the story kept you on the edge of your seat. It’s a very romantic tale with some spice scattered throughout so there’s a little of everything for everyone (if you love romance). I think you need to buy this book and check it out. It’s a new favorite for me.
